"swear in" in Chinese (Simplified)
宣誓就职宣誓就任
Definition
让某人正式就任职位(尤其是政府或官方职位),通过宣誓或正式承诺来完成这一过程。
Usage Notes (Chinese (Simplified))
常用于正式或法律场合,常见于政府官员、法官、警察等。多用被动语态:“He was sworn in.” 不要与“swear”(骂人)混淆。通常接职位:'sworn in as president.'
Examples
The new mayor will be sworn in tomorrow.
新市长将于明天**宣誓就任**。
The judges were sworn in before starting their work.
法官们在开始工作前已**宣誓就职**。
You must be sworn in before becoming a police officer.
在成为警察之前,你必须**宣誓就职**。
He was finally sworn in as president after weeks of waiting.
经过数周的等待,他终于**宣誓就任**总统。
Everybody stood and clapped as the minister was sworn in.
部长**宣誓就职**时,大家都起立鼓掌。
It’s an old tradition to be sworn in with your hand on a book.
手放在书上**宣誓就职**是一项古老的传统。
